Changes in the Body Due to Water
Water is the most crucial element for our health. When you start drinking enough water regularly, your body experiences positive changes.
First and foremost, your skin starts to glow. Water helps flush out toxins from the body, making the skin clear and radiant.
The body's energy levels improve because water keeps you hydrated and reduces fatigue.
The digestive system functions more efficiently, reducing issues like constipation.
Water also helps in controlling hunger.
Sometimes, thirst is mistaken for hunger, but drinking enough water helps curb unnecessary food cravings.
Water also helps boost metabolism, aiding in faster calorie burning.
Drinking water refreshes both your skin and body. Start incorporating it into your routine and notice how your body and skin gradually begin to glow.
How to Start Drinking Water Regularly
Drinking enough water may lead to frequent bathroom visits initially. Because of this, many people avoid drinking water unless they are extremely thirsty.
However, when you start drinking enough water, your body learns to process it efficiently. As you make it a part of your routine, your body adapts, and the frequent urination issue normalizes over time. In the beginning, drink water in small amounts at regular intervals throughout the day. Avoid drinking too much at once, as it can make you feel bloated. Develop a habit of drinking a glass of water as soon as you wake up, and then continue sipping water every hour. Be mindful of drinking water in the afternoon and evening, but avoid excessive consumption just before bedtime, as it may cause frequent disruptions during sleep.
How to Make Drinking Water a Habit
Incorporating the habit of drinking water into your daily routine is not as difficult as it seems. Start by drinking a glass of water first thing in the morning.
This will not only keep your body hydrated but also activate your digestive system and maintain healthy skin. Always carry a water bottle with you and refill it whenever it gets empty. If you tend to forget to drink water, set reminders on your phone.
To make drinking water more enjoyable, add lemon slices, mint, or cucumber for a refreshing taste. When water tastes good, you’ll be tempted to drink more. Make it a habit to drink water some time after meals to aid digestion. Aim to drink at least 8 to 10 glasses of water daily. Gradually, your body will get used to this habit.
